Advocare is one of the region’s leading physician-owned, multi-specialty medical organizations. We’re committed to providing exceptional patient care and creating an engaging, supportive environment for our physicians and employees. We are seeking a Director of Total Rewards to join our growing HR team and help shape the future of benefits, compensation, and employee experience across Advocare.
About the Role
The Director of Total Rewards is a key strategic and operational partner responsible for managing Advocare’s full suite of total rewards programs - including benefits, compensation, and learning/development initiatives. This role ensures that our programs are competitive, compliant, data-driven, and aligned with our mission to support physicians, non-physician providers, and staff.
You’ll work closely with HR, Payroll, Care Centers, and external vendors to deliver high-quality programs, support day-to-day operations, analyze data, and enhance the employee experience through clear communication and thoughtful program design.
This role reports directly to the Vice President of Human Resources and provides a unique opportunity to make a meaningful impact in a dynamic healthcare organization.

The anticipated salary range for this role is $140,000 - $150,000, depending on a variety of factors such as skills, experience, and education. In addition, Advocare offers a comprehensive benefits package that includes multiple medical and prescription coverage options; dental and vision plans; Health Savings Accounts (HSAs) and Flexible Spending Accounts (FSAs); and a range of voluntary insurance offerings such as critical illness, cancer, accident, hospital indemnity, disability, and life/AD&D coverage. Employees also have access to a 401(k) retirement savings plan, paid time off (PTO), commuter benefits, and group auto and homeowners insurance. Additional information about eligibility and enrollment will be provided during the hiring process.
